ELSEWHERE IN ASIA Vol 6, Issue 3 (March 2005)
In Japan, February saw the first-ever electricity to water crossover. Kansai Electric Power Co., better known as Kepco, will be the first electric company to pick up a water service outsourcing contract, for Miki in Hyogo Prefecture.
